About Marcus Palimenio PT, DPT
Marcus attended the University of Nebraska-Omaha where he studied athletic training and had the opportunity to work with a number of high school, college, and professional sports and athletes. Upon graduation he briefly worked in research at Creighton University prior to and during physical therapy school where he had the opportunity to co-author a number of presentations and publications. This experience led him to attend Creighton University where he earned a Doctorate of Physical Therapy. Marcus has over 6 years of outpatient orthopedics experience and has pursued continuing education in the management of spine and extremity injuries as well as dry needling. In addition to his outpatient focus, he works part-time in the acute care setting to remain a well-rounded clinician.
